A bang and a flash in the hubbub and haze - GW170817 / GRB 170817A and noises limiting gravitational wave detectors

Gamma-ray bursts and gravitational waves at audio frequencies have long been thought to have common astrophysical origins. This has been confirmed with the joint observation of GW170817 and GRB 170817A due to the merger of two neutron stars. This exceptional event has confirmed expectations, but also proved to be an extremely powerful and precise test of general relativity. It was at the origin of observation of afterglow emission at all electromagnetic wavelength with time evolution observed at the second, hours, days and months time scales. To make this and future observation possible, gravitational wave detector noise instrumental noise needs to be understood. There are many source, in particular I describe in more detail the noise of monolithic optical filter cavities, radio-frequency modulation sideband amplitude, radio-frequency digital demodulation, laser frequency and light back-scatter. The last one is often considered unpredictable, but with a detailed study it can be in fact precisely modeled and even used to calibrate gravitational wave detectors.
